MCM: Lukwago Henry, MUBS’ GRC with Bigger Aspirations

As the holidays come to an end and campus elections kick off, today being a Monday, the Bee crushed on Lukwago Henry.

Lukwago Henry is a second-year student at Makerere University Business School (MUBS), pursuing a Bachelor’s degree in Entrepreneurship.

Lukwago is a prominent MUBS politician from the UYD party, currently serving as the off-campus GRC, and is an aspiring 28th Guild President.

Henry’s vision statement is: “To transform the Makerere University Business School (MUBS) student experience through inclusive, innovative, and accountable leadership.”

Henry’s Core Values:

  1. Student-Centricity: Prioritizing student needs, concerns, and aspirations.
  2. Inclusivity: Fostering a culture of diversity, equity, and social justice.
  3. Transparency: Ensuring accountability, openness, and honesty in all Guild activities.
  4. Collaboration: Building strong relationships with students, faculty, and stakeholders.

Henry’s Key Areas of Focus:

  1. Campus Infrastructure:
    • Improve study spaces, recreational facilities, and accessibility.
    • Organize regular events, workshops, and seminars to promote academic, personal, and professional growth.
  2. Academic Support and Advocacy:
    • Establish a robust academic support system, including mentorship programs, tutoring services, and academic advising.
    • Advocate for students’ rights and interests, particularly regarding academic policies, fees, and scholarships.
  3. Career Development and Employability:
    • Strengthen industry partnerships to provide internship, job, and entrepreneurship opportunities.
    • Develop and implement career guidance programs, including resume building, interview preparation, and professional networking.
  4. Financial Management and Transparency:
    • Ensure transparent and accountable management of Guild finances.
    • Explore alternative funding sources to support student initiatives and projects.
  5. Health, Wellness, and Safety:
    • Promote physical and mental well-being through health awareness campaigns, fitness programs, and counseling services.
    • Enhance campus safety and security measures, including emergency response systems and improved lighting.
